design history @dribbble
Going back there were 4 phases:
1. people used dribbble to share wip with friends.
- this created community
- we liked this
2. then they started posting finished work
- this started gaining attention from people hiring designers
- more good work, more people seeking designers
- we liked this
3. then they wanted to scale everything
- someone had the idea "we could multiply our numbers overnight if we killed invites"
- this oversaturated and devalued the talent and the leads
- we did not like this
4. leads did increase though so they turned their attention to monetizing those
- i cannot say this loud enough......
🗣️ DESIGNERS DO NOT WANT YOU TO TAKE A % OF THEIR HARD EARNED WORK 🗣️
- however, they don't mind paying more for pro if they're getting leads, but this is overlooked
- this is not just this week. this started under zack.
- same story, new ceo
- we did not / do not like this
---
designers used to not have portfolios because they had dribbble...
hiring managers and clients used to come to dribbble because they trusted it as a talent source. that's where we need to get back to.
core monetization focuses that we are ok with and need attention:
- jobs/leads
- pro
- ad
- partnerships
- teams
- agency + enterprise (new)
Every UX designer walking into a cockpit: Clutter!
Every pilot walking into a cockpit: Clarity!
The word "clutter" is terribly overused in the UX/design field, commonly serving as a superficial critique of decoration while often ignoring the design's true context.
